I'm not advocating changing the API for no reason / just to piss off out of tree developers. I'm just trying to make clear that in these cases, 'stable' is just an observation -- not something you can count on. > It is the lack of an ABI that is most frustrating to these users. And the presence of an ABI would be _very_ frustrating to core developers. Not only would these people suffer, everyone would -- developer time would be wasted dealing with cruft, and forward progress would be slowed. > > > Another thing to consider is that the first step for many organizations > > > in opening a driver under GPL is to release a proprietary module that > > > at least first works. > > > > If the driver is an old-tech Linux port, then it seems there isn't too > > much stopping them from doing this today (aside from the fact that some > > people think proprietary modules are murky anyway). Perhaps another term may have been more appropriate. What I mean by 'old tech' is more 'existing code' -- ie, something you would port. And these organizations _are_ afforded the opportunity to take the first step -- that's why interfaces critical to drivers are currently EXPORT_SYMBOL(). > I don't think that it is fair to say that an unstable API/ABI, in of > itself, provides an incentive to open an existing proprietary driver. Sure it does, depending on your perspective and what you're willing to consider. The lack of a stable API/ABI means that if you don't want to have to do work tracking the kernel, you should push to have your drivers merged. > > We're not as perfect as I wish we were.
